Competitive Landscape of Leading Manufacturers in the Intra-Aortic Balloon Pump Industry
Intra-aortic balloon pumps (IABPs) have long been a cornerstone of mechanical circulatory support, offering lifesaving assistance to patients experiencing severe cardiac dysfunction. These devices help stabilize hemodynamics by improving coronary perfusion and reducing the workload on the heart, making them essential tools in treating cardiogenic shock, acute myocardial infarction, and complications following cardiac surgery. As cardiovascular diseases continue to rise globally, the demand for advanced cardiac support systems such as IABPs remains strong.
The Intra Aortic Balloon Pumps Market is anticipated to grow steadily throughout the forecast period of 2023–2030, expanding from USD 268.31 million to USD 381.56 million at a CAGR of 4.50%. Increasing incidence of heart failure, improvements in critical care infrastructure, and wider adoption of circulatory support devices in both developed and emerging economies are key contributors to this growth.
Growing Role of Intra-Aortic Balloon Pumps in Cardiac Care
IABPs work through counterpulsation, augmenting diastolic pressure and reducing afterload to enhance cardiac output. This therapeutic approach helps maintain organ perfusion, stabilize blood pressure, and reduce myocardial oxygen demand—critical factors in managing unstable cardiac patients. As a minimally invasive mechanical support option, IABPs are frequently used in emergency departments, catheterization labs, and intensive care units.

Due to increasing prevalence of acute cardiac conditions such as myocardial infarction, arrhythmias, and advanced heart failure, the clinical need for IABP devices continues to rise. They are commonly employed as a bridge-to-recovery, bridge-to-surgery, or bridge-to-advanced-support therapy, depending on patient condition. Their reliability, ease of use, and rapid hemodynamic benefits make them indispensable in critical cardiac procedures.
While newer mechanical circulatory support devices are emerging, IABPs remain widely used due to their proven safety profile, cost-effectiveness, and strong clinical outcomes in specific patient populations. Hospitals worldwide continue to adopt these devices to improve survival and treatment effectiveness in high-risk cardiac cases.

Major Applications of Intra-Aortic Balloon Pumps
- Cardiogenic Shock Management
IABPs help stabilize cardiac output in patients with severely impaired heart function following myocardial infarction or surgery.
- Acute Myocardial Infarction (AMI)
They improve coronary artery perfusion, supporting recovery and reducing complications in high-risk AMI patients.
- Post-Cardiac Surgery Support
IABPs are frequently used to support patients who experience difficulty weaning from bypass machines or who develop postoperative complications.
- Bridge-to-Intervention Therapy
They serve as temporary circulatory support for patients awaiting heart surgery, PCI procedures, or advanced mechanical support.
- Severe Heart Failure Cases
IABPs offer short-term stabilization to reduce symptoms and improve perfusion in decompensated heart failure patients.
